    International Rules back on the agenda.

    SENIOR Gaelic football official Pat Daly said violence would be at the top of the agenda when the GAA and the AFL meet in October to discuss the revival of the International Rules series.

    The GAA pulled out of the series after violent scenes marred last year?s second test in Croke Park.
